The Town of Edson has reduced its fire restriction to a fire advisory following recent rainfall and cooler temperatures.
Under the advisory, existing permits will remain valid and new permits will be issued on a case-by-case basis, although no heavy fuel permits will be approved.
Safe wood campfires within fire rings (permitted and approved) are allowed within the Town of Edson. Never leave a fire unattended and ensure it’s completely out when leaving it.
Meantime, use of spark arrestors is highly recommended.
The following are also approved:
- CSA approved or ULC certified gas or propane barbeques used for cooking
- CSA approved or ULC certified Wood Pellet Smokers
- Propane and natural gas fire pits
- Catalytic or infrared-style heaters
- Electric or propane meat smokers
Residents are also reminded to always properly dispose of smoking materials including cannabis, cigarettes, cigars, matches or lighters.
